The Committee on Missing Persons in Cyprus (CMP) has thanked Cyprus for its latest generous donation of €240,000 which has enabled the CMP to extend the working area of its Anthropological Laboratory to accommodate a larger team of scientists in order to expedite the identification process of the remains of missing persons within the framework of its project on the Exhumation, Identification and Return of Remains of Missing Persons in Cyprus.
To date, human remains representing over 830 individuals have been exhumed while over 310 missing persons have been identified and their remains returned to the families concerned.
The CMP is aiming to locate, exhume, identify and return as many remains as possible and to do everything needed in order to bring an end to the uncertainty which has affected so many families for so many years, it added.
